#6452b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6452b5 is composed of 39.2% red, 32.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 250.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 51.6%. #6452b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8a4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6452b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6452b5 has RGB values of R:100, G:82,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6574773.

Shades and Tints of #6452b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030206 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6452b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828286 is the less saturated color, while #3a10f8 is the most saturated one.
